Descripción
Sumario:In the title compound, C(15)H(8)Cl(4)N(2)O, the quinoxaline ring system is almost planar, with a dihedral angle between the benzene and pyrazine rings of 3.1 (2)°. The 2,4-dichloro­phenyl ring is approximately perpendicular to the pyrazine ring, with a dihedral angle of 86.47 (13)° between them. The crystal packing features inter­molecular N—H⋯O hydrogen bonds and π–π stacking inter­actions, with centroid–centroid distances in the range 3.699 (3)–4.054 (3) Å.
